Cons

Save the money and invest in a better carrier. The other babybjorn models seem a lot more supportive so i would check those out before thinking about the original. Absolutely horrible in comparison to an ergo or tula.

My back gets sore after carrying my infant(3 weeks, 9lb) for 20 mins. My baby is 3 months old at 13lbs, and it's hurting my shoulders.

The baby also hangs by their * in this product which leaves their legs dangling which i don't feel is very good for them. Very uncomfortable for wearing a baby any larger than newborn.

The buckle and straps are so cumbersome. The connector in the back freely slides so that your adjustments for size never stay in place.
